GAD201 Burritt on the Mountain
Burritt on the Mountain is a 167-acre living history park featuring the 1938 mansion of Dr. William Burritt and a historic park with relocated 19th-century homes, a blacksmith shop and other structures, offering a glimpse into early American life with period interpreters and nature trails on Round Top Mountain.

GAD202 Apples, Foliage, and Marble: Small Towns with Big Views
Please join us for a trip to the Ellijays of North Georgia, where we can sample and purchase a wide variety of apples, see the beautiful fall foliage the mountains have to offer, attend a Marble Festival and tour a marble quarry. The famous pink, or Etowah, marble is mined in nearby Jasper, Georgia.

GAD203 Bulloch Hall: An Atlanta Plantation with Presidential Times
Bulloch Hall, a fine example of temple-style Greek Revival architecture, was completed in 1839 for Maj. James Stephens Bulloch and his family. Bulloch Hall is a house museum, featuring period rooms, and was the site of the December 1853 marriage between Martha "Mittie" Bulloch and Theodore Roosevelt, the elder, of New York. Their son, Theodore, was the 26th President of the United States, and their granddaughter was First Lady Anna Eleanor Roosevelt. The grounds include a reconstructed slave cabin and slave garden, summer house, privies and demonstration garden. The surrounding historic district features many structures of the Civil War period, including Smith Plantation, Barrington Hall and The Roswell Presbyterian Church. The former locations of several mills burned by Federal troops on their march to Atlanta are marked.
